Sanwich Artist applicants have rated the interview process at Subway with 1.7 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 29% positive. To compare, the company-average is 65.8%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Sanwich Artist roles take an average of 9 days to get hired, when considering 8 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Subway overall takes an average of 7 days.
Common stages of the interview process at Subway as a Sanwich Artist according to 8 Glassdoor interviews include:
One on one interview: 57%
Skills test: 29%
Background check: 14%

i got an interview call from manager after I applied this position on kijiji. He gave me an interview for half an hour, asked some simple and basic questions. It was not very hard.

It was alright, a group interview. It wasn't too formal and it was an interesting selection of people in the group. There was one interviewer and four interviewees (including myself). I found it interesting that the interview was held in the middle of the store (which was pretty small) and so customers were able to watch what was going on.
